Zargg,

I too have the WA73-EQ, and I love it as my vocal chain Mic Pre. I was watching a video that says were using the pre-amp wrong if we didn't have the output all the way up and then dial in the Line or the Mic signal.  I then  watched some Neve 1073 videos from other engineers discussing their use and that was their consensus also.
